Title

Motion Vector based Robust Video Hash

Abstract
A novel robust video hashing scheme is proposed in thispaper. Unlike most existing robust video hashing algorithms, theproposed video hash is generated based on the motion vectorsinstead of the image textures in the video stream. Therefore,neither full decoding of the video stream nor complex computationof pixel values is required. Based on analysis of motion vectorproperties regarding their suitability for robust hashing, animproved feature extraction mechanism is proposed and severaloptimization mechanisms are introduced in order to achieve betterrobustness and discriminability. The proposed hashing scheme isevaluated by a large and modern video data set and theexperimental results demonstrate the excellent performance of theproposed hashing algorithm, which is comparable or even betterthan the complicated texture-based approaches.
